WebSep 21, 2024 · By Juan Pablo Garnham, The Texas Tribune Sept. 21, 2024 “High-speed train between Dallas and Houston gets federal approval” was first published by The Texas Tribune, a nonprofit, nonpartisan media organization that informs Texans — and engages with them — about public policy, politics, government and statewide issues. … WebHouston was an entrepreneurial place from the moment of its founding. In 1832 two brothers from new York State, John K. Allen, a shopkeeper and dreamer, and his brother Augustus, a bookkeeper and a pragmatist, joined hundreds of Americans who gobbled up cheap scrip offered by Galveston Land Company and authorized by Mexico. WebAug 31, 2024 · The highly anticipated bullet train project that would link Dallas and Houston is losing momentum.
